强迫油冷电磁除铁器在输煤港口中的应用 |

随着国民经济的快速发展,我国钢铁、电力、煤炭等行业也得到了突飞猛进的发展,需要的原料更多,同时对原材料的质量也提出了更高的要求,去除铁磁性杂质的任务也越来越艰巨。我国港口行业货物吞吐量由新中国成立初期1000万吨增长到2009年的76.57亿吨,货物吞吐量超过亿吨的港口达到20个,连续7年保持世界第一。我国港口集装箱吞吐量同样保持连续7年世界第一,近10年年均增长率达30%。我国已构成“布局合理、层次分明、功能齐全:的港口格局。在各大输煤港口码头、电力、冶金、煤炭、建材、矿山、粮食、化工等行业需求量逐渐增多。尤其在煤炭行业中,煤炭中混有雷管及残屑、铁钉等铁杂质,不仅影响煤矿、装货港的安全生产,而且给卸港及用户造成极坏影响,致使出口煤炭的质量和声誉下降。为了提高港口的输送能力,港口输送不断加大物料层厚度、提高带速,需求大型高除铁率的精细除铁设备,在此种情况下,强迫油冷电磁除铁器应运而生。 With the rapid development of the national economy, China's iron and steel, electric power, coal and other industries has also been rapid development, need more raw materials, at the same time, the quality of raw materials is also put forward higher requirements, the removal of the ferromagnetic impurities increasinglydifficult task. The cargo throughput of China's port industry increased from 10 million tons to 76.57 tons in 2009 at the beginning of the founding of new China, and reached 20 ports with cargo handling capacity exceeding 100 million tons, keeping the world for the first time in 7 years. Container throughput in China has remained the first in the world for 7 consecutive years, with an average annual growth rate of 30% over the past 10 years. China has formed a port layout with reasonable layout, clear levels and complete functions. In major coal handling ports, ports, electricity, metallurgy, coal, building materials, mines, food, chemical and other industries, demand has increased. Especially in the coal industry, coal mixed with detonator and scraps, iron nails and other impurities, not only affects the safety production of coal mine, port of loading, but also caused extremely bad influence to the discharge port and the user, resulting in decline in the export of coal quality and reputation. In order to improve the transmission capacity of the port, the port transportation increasing material thickness and increase speed, high demand of large iron removal rate of fine iron removal equipment, in this case, the forced oil cooled electromagnetic separator came into being. 我国现在的电磁除铁器普遍采用的技术: Technology adopted by electromagnetic Separators in our country: 1、磁系性能主要满足额定吊高处某一点的磁场强度,磁系分布面积较小,当运用到港口进行除铁时,给料速度达到4.5m/s以上,采用普通电磁除铁器只能吸起皮带表面的铁件,除铁率不到30% 1, the magnetic system performance to meet the main strength of the magnetic field of a high rated lifting point of the magnetic distribution area is small, when applied to the port for iron removal, the feeding speed can reach more than 4.5m/s, the ordinary electromagnetic Separators can only absorb iron belt surface, the iron removal rate of less than 30% 2、普通电磁除铁器磁系结构通常是将线圈自身散热通道进行散热,当磁场强度提高到1500GS以上时,磁系内部自身散热通道无法满足设备散热的需求。 2. The magnetic structure of the ordinary electromagnetic iron remover is usually to heat the cooling channel of the coil itself. When the magnetic field strength is increased to more than 1500GS, the internal heat sink of the magnetic system can not meet the demand of the heat dissipation of the equipment. 3、普通电磁除铁器传动系统带速在2-3m/s左右,然而港口输送带通常在4-6m/s,使得现在除铁器处理量无法满足使用效果要求,除铁效果降低。 3, ordinary electromagnetic iron drive system with speed at about 2-3m/s, however, the port conveyor belt is usually in 4-6m/s, so that now the amount of iron removal can not meet the requirements of use, the effect of iron removal is reduced. 强迫油冷除铁器与大型普通油冷除铁器相比,普通油冷除铁器的性能比较低,特别是在除净率要求很高的一些特殊的场合,如大件或细小铁件很难清除,如用港口输送物料洁净用除铁器可以做到性能足,结构紧凑,适合于除铁要求更高的生产场所,最后是大型普通除铁器的适应环境受限,而如用港口输送物料洁净用除铁器可以做到设计合理、适合在现场非常恶劣的环境下工作,如潮湿、粉尘较大、盐雾腐蚀严重的场所,其物料层比较厚的,输送机皮带事速比较高的情况下的物料中,均能清除铁磁性杂铁,适用范围极广。因此适合港口输送物料中带速较高料层较厚,除铁环境恶劣等现场,能够达到精细除铁的目的。 Forced oil cooled separator oil separator and large common cold compared to performance of ordinary oil cooling separators is relatively low, especially in some special occasions, in addition to the net rate is high, such as the large or small pieces of iron is difficult to remove, such as the use of materials for cleaning port separators can do performance, structure compact, suitable for removing iron demanding production sites, and finally large ordinary separators to adapt to the environment is limited, and as for the port transport material with the addition of clean iron can do reasonable design, suitable for a site is very harsh environments, such as humidity, large dust, salt fog corrosion serious place, its material a relatively thick layer of conveyor belt, what speed under the condition of relatively high material, can remove ferromagnetic iron impurities, wide application. Therefore, it is suitable for the port to transport materials with high belt speed, thicker material layer and bad iron environment, so as to achieve the goal of fine iron removal. |
